Decadent Delights: Shrimp & Lobster Biscuit Pot Pie Bliss

Learn how to make delicious Shrimp & Lobster Biscuit Pot Pie. Easy recipe with step-by-step instructions.

  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ale

Gathering the ingredients is like assembling a little treasure chest of flavors.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• 1 pound of sh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1 pound of lobster meat, cooked and chopped
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 2 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 1 cup of frozen peas
  • 2 cups of diced carrots
  • 1 teaspoon of sal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on of black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on of thyme
  • 1/4 cup of all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ups of seafood stock
  • 1 cup of heavy cream
  • 2 cups of biscuit mix
  • 1/2 cup of milk
  • 1/4 cup of melted butter

Feel free to substitute the seafood stock with chicken stock if that’s what you have on hand. Remember, cooking is about using what’s available and making it work—much like my mom did with her magical can of tomatoes.

Instructions

Time to roll up those sleeves and dive into the heart of this dish. Here’s how you can bring this delicious pot pie to life: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ures everything cooks evenly and to perfection.
  2.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ion and garlic, sautéing until they’re fragrant and translucent, about 5 minutes.
  3. Stir in the diced carrots and peas, cooking for another 3 minutes until they start to soften.
  4. Add the shrimp and cook until they’re pink and opaque, about 4 minutes. Stir in the lobster, salt, pepper, and thyme.
  5. Sprinkle the flour over the mixture, stirring constantly for 2 minutes to cook out the raw taste.
  6. Gradually pour in the seafood stock and heavy cream, stirring to combine. Simmer until the mixture thickens, about 5 minutes.
  7. Pour the seafood filling into a deep ovenproof dish, spreading it evenly.
  8. In a separate bowl, mix the biscuit mix with milk and melted butter until a dough forms.
  9. Spoon the biscuit dough over the seafood mixture, covering as much surface as possible.
  10.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the biscuit topping is golden brown and cooked through. Let it cool for a few minutes before serving.
